Cowboys vs. Zombies delivers a new take on tower defense by featuring quality 3D art, mobile towers, and unpredictable swarming zombie hoards. You play the Sheriff in charge of defending the town of UnDeadwood with your posse of colorful cowboy and cowgirl characters. Hire cowboys for your posse, upgrade, and position them wisely to defend against wave after wave of zombies hell-bent on destroying the town.

Expanding on the Tower Defense genre, Tall Chair’s Cowboys vs. Zombies uses the environments to add to the strategy. Invading zombies destroy the buildings, which reduces the safe places from which your cowboys can defend. Choosing which buildings to defend and when to fall back is key to surviving. When the zombies have leveled the town, the Sheriff is vulnerable. Loose the Sheriff and you lose the game.
